eth/fetcher: fix announcement drop logic (#32210)
This PR fixes an issue in the tx_fetcher DoS prevention logic where the code keeps the overflow amount (`want - maxTxAnnounces`) instead of the allowed amount (`maxTxAnnounces - used`). The specific changes are: - Correct slice indexing in the announcement drop logic - Extend the overflow test case to cover the inversion scenario
